Sauté the vegetables
Start your lemon lentil soup journey by prepping your base. You’ll need an onion, some carrots, and celery—these aromatics will form a robust foundation of flavor.
- Chop these veggies finely to ensure they cook evenly.
- Heat about 2 tablespoons of olive oil in a large pot over medium heat.
- Add the chopped onion and sauté for approximately 5 minutes, until soft and translucent.
- Toss in the carrots and celery, cooking for another 5 minutes until they start to soften.
This not only creates a delightful aroma in your kitchen but also sets the stage for the rich tastes to come!
Add garlic and spices
Once your vegetables are looking good, it’s time to add some depth with garlic and spices.
- Mince 3 cloves of garlic and add them to the pot.
- Stir in spices like cumin, coriander, and a pinch of cayenne for a kick. These spices will give your lemon lentil soup a warm, inviting flavor profile.
- Cook for another 1-2 minutes until the garlic is fragrant.

Combine lentils and broth
Now for the star of the show—lentils!
- Rinse 1 cup of dried lentils under cold water to remove any impurities.
- Pour the lentils into the pot and mix them with the sautéed veggies.
- Add 4 cups of vegetable or chicken broth for a heartier flavor.

Simmer until tender
Bring your soup to a rolling boil, then lower the heat to let it simmer.
- Cover the pot and let it cook for 25-30 minutes, or until the lentils are tender.

Blend for a creamy texture
For a luxurious, creamy finish, you can blend part of your lemon lentil soup.
- Using an immersion blender, blend the soup until it’s mostly smooth, or transfer it to a countertop blender in batches.
- If you appreciate a bit of texture, feel free to leave some lentils whole.

Add lemon juice and zest
Just before serving, it’s time to introduce that bright, zesty flavor that’ll make your lemon lentil soup truly pop.
- Squeeze the juice of 1-2 lemons into the pot, adding zest from the lemons as well.
- Stir well to incorporate the citrusy goodness.

How to Store Leftovers Effectively
If you find yourself with leftover lemon lentil soup, you’re in luck! Proper storage can help you enjoy this delicious dish for days. Transfer the soup to an airtight container and refrigerate it for up to five days. For longer storage, consider freezing individual portions in freezer-safe containers. Just remember to leave some space at the top, as liquids expand when frozen. When you’re ready to enjoy it again, simply thaw overnight in the refrigerator and reheat on the stove. Can I freeze lemon lentil soup?
Absolutely! Freezing lemon lentil soup is a great way to meal prep or save leftovers for a rainy day. Simply let the soup cool to room temperature, then transfer it to an airtight container or freezer bag. It should keep well in the freezer for up to 3 months. When you’re ready to enjoy it, just thaw it in the refrigerator overnight, and reheat on the stovetop or in the microwave.
How long does lemon lentil soup last in the refrigerator?
Once prepared, your lemon lentil soup can last in the refrigerator for about 4 to 5 days. Just be sure to store it in a sealed container to maintain its freshness. If you notice any changes in color, smell, or texture, it’s best to discard it. Want to extend the life of your soup? Consider freezing it!
What are the best substitutions for lentils?
If you’re in a pinch or simply looking to vary your soup, there are several fantastic alternatives to lentils. Here are a few options:
- Split peas: These are similar in texture and require a similar cooking time.
- Chickpeas (garbanzo beans): They offer a different flavor but can add protein and fiber.
- Quinoa: This gluten-free option adds a pleasant nutty flavor and works well within the soup.
- Barley: If you’re not strictly gluten-free, barley offers a hearty texture.

PrintLemon Lentil Soup: The Best Comforting Recipe for Home Cooks
A delicious and comforting lemon lentil soup that is perfect for home cooks looking to warm up on a chilly day.
- Prep Time: 10 minutes
- Cook Time: 30 minutes
- Total Time: 40 minutes
- Yield: 4 servings 1x
- Category: Soup
- Method: Stovetop
- Cuisine: Mediterranean
- Diet: Vegan
Ingredients
- 1 cup lentils
- 6 cups vegetable broth
- 1 tablespoon olive oil
- 1 onion, chopped
- 2 carrots, diced
- 2 celery stalks, diced
- 3 garlic cloves, minced
- 1 teaspoon ground cumin
- 1/2 teaspoon turmeric
- 1/4 teaspoon black pepper
- 1/4 cup lemon juice
- 1 bay leaf
- Salt to taste
Instructions
- In a large pot, heat the olive oil over medium heat.
- Add the onion, carrots, and celery, and sauté until softened.
- Add the garlic, cumin, turmeric, and black pepper; cook for an additional minute.
- Add the lentils, vegetable broth, and bay leaf, then bring to a boil.
- Reduce heat and simmer for about 30 minutes, or until the lentils are tender.
- Stir in the lemon juice and season with salt to taste.
- Remove the bay leaf and serve hot.
